One person injured in Readstown accident

READSTOWN, Wis. – The Vernon County Sheriff’s Office reports that on Friday, October 26, at 1:30 p.m., the Vernon County 9-1-1 Dispatch Center was notified of a two vehicle accident on US Highway 14 at the intersection of County Road X, in the Town of Kickapoo.

According to the Sheriff’s Office Kaiden Gander, 18, of Readstown was traveling east on US Highway 14. Toby Skov, 53, of Viola was attempting to cross US Highway 14 from Church Road to County Road X. Skov did not see the Gander vehicle and they collided. A passenger in the Gander vehicle, Terrie Gander, 61, of Lone Rock was transported by Readstown Ambulance to Vernon Memorial Healthcare for non-life threatening injuries. Two other passengers in the Gander vehicle were not injured.

All parties were wearing seatbelts at the time of the accident.
